Listed for: $3,950,000 by Andrew Manning REALTOR® with Berkshire Hathaway HomeServices California Properties (DRE Lic # 00941825) The Asher Residence by Rodney Walker is considered one of his greatest works and an extraordinary and historic example of early midcentury Los Angeles architecture. Rodney Walker, AIA, who contributed three influential projects to the Case Study House program, was commissioned by the Asher family to develop this property which was completed in 1949. It stands as an exquisitely composed study in redwood, glass, and post-and-beam structure, capturing the essence of indoor/outdoor California living. The residence is a quiet sanctuary that explores the methodology of light as architecture. Every room is composed to draw the landscape and views inward, allowing the outdoors to become a living extension of the interior. Glass walls, shifting shadows, and open volumes transform movement through the home. Many elements are experimental for their time, including a modular concept that allows the expansive living spaces to be easily reconfigured, enabling the home to shift from four to five bedrooms if needed. Upon completion, the house was photographed by Julius Shulman, affirming its place as a significant statement of modernist design. Set high atop the Santa Monica Mountains, the property sits on a private lane between Mulholland Drive and Beverly Glen, on the border of Sherman Oaks and Bel Air. Its position affords inspiring 180degree jetliner views of the San Fernando Valley and the San Gabriel Mountains, with sunlight tracing the home from sunrise to sunset. The 0.58acre site is exceptional: a rare large usable lot in the hills with a lawn that wraps two sides of the structure, framed by pockets of architectural desert planting and mature avocado, walnut, pomegranate, magnolia, and olive trees that create a lush, tropical environment. The scale and layout of the home, combined with its generous outdoor spaces, make it clear that this is a property designed for family, guests, and effortless entertaining. Thoughtfully restored and sensitively updated, the Asher Residence remains a rare, intact expression of Walker's architectural philosophy, a place where structure and nature are held in perfect balance within a work of art shaped by one of California's most influential modernists.
